The Role of Automation in Simplifying Daily Home Routines

A home has a way of asking for attention throughout the day, and most of those requests do not feel significant on their own. You adjust the lights before settling in, double-check the door while heading out, pause mid-task to start an appliance, then reconsider later to turn it off.

None of this feels demanding in isolation, though it creates involvement that never fully disappears. 

Automation changes everything completely. The focus moves away from managing the home piece by piece and shifts toward letting the space follow your routine without needing constant input.

Tasks begin to align with your habits rather than interrupt them. The home starts feeling predictable and supportive in a way that does not call attention to itself.

Garage Flow

Garage spaces often sit in an in-between state where they have potential for daily use, though they require effort to feel comfortable or functional. You might want to keep the space open for airflow during the day or use it as a casual extension of the home, yet adjusting it each time can feel like a small project on its own. This repeated setup tends to limit how naturally the space fits into everyday routines.

Motorized garage door screens change that experience by removing the need for constant adjustment and turning the transition into something seamless.

With the best motorized garage door screens, airflow, light, and comfort stay balanced in a way that feels consistent without extra effort. The space remains ready to use, whether it is for a quick break, a longer stretch of time, or simply leaving it open without thinking about it. 

Voice Control

Managing small tasks throughout the home often requires just enough effort to interrupt your focus. Reaching for switches, opening apps, or adjusting settings may only take a moment, though each action pulls your attention away from what you were doing. 

Voice control changes how those interactions happen by allowing the environment to respond without requiring physical engagement. You remain where you are, continue your activity, and still adjust the space around you. 

Scheduled Appliances

There is a quiet mental load that comes from keeping track of recurring tasks, especially the ones that need to happen at the right time. Running the dishwasher, starting laundry, or remembering to switch something off later tends to sit in the back of your mind until it is completed. 

Scheduled appliances remove that background tracking by handling tasks automatically at set times. Once the schedule is in place, those responsibilities fall into a consistent pattern that no longer requires attention.

Laundry cycles begin without reminders, kitchen tasks align with your routine, and the home maintains itself in ways that feel predictable. 

Smart Security

Security often brings with it a sense of responsibility that extends beyond the moment. Locking doors, checking entry points, and occasionally reviewing camera feeds can turn into habits that repeat throughout the day. That level of involvement can create a subtle sense of unease, even in situations where everything is functioning as it should.

Smart security systems shift that experience by allowing the home to monitor itself and communicate only when necessary. Doors secure automatically based on your routine, activity is tracked in the background, and updates are delivered when something actually requires attention. 

Automated Cleaning

Maintaining a clean space often depends on consistency, though daily schedules do not always allow for it. Cleaning tends to happen in greater efforts once things begin to feel out of place, which creates a cycle of buildup followed by reset. 

Automated cleaning devices handle upkeep in smaller, more frequent intervals. Floors remain in order, dust stays controlled, and the overall space holds its condition without requiring dedicated time for each reset. The result is not just a cleaner home, but one that feels consistently aligned with how you want it to function. 

Kitchen That Moves with You

The kitchen often carries the most activity in a home, which means it also carries the most repetition. Preparing meals, adjusting settings, checking timers, and managing multiple steps at once can create a rhythm that feels slightly fragmented. Each action pulls your focus in a different direction, even if the process itself is familiar.

Smart kitchen features begin to smooth out that rhythm by handling certain steps in the background. Pre-set cooking modes, automated timing, and connected appliances allow tasks to progress without constant checking. You move through the process with more continuity, focusing on what you are doing rather than managing each step individually. 

Irrigation Without the Effort

Outdoor maintenance tends to follow a pattern where attention comes in bursts—watering the lawn, adjusting for weather, remembering to cover certain areas while skipping others.

It becomes another layer of responsibility that sits alongside everything else in your routine. Even with the best intentions, consistency can slip, and the results start to show in uneven growth or areas that feel neglected.

Timed irrigation systems bring structure into that process in a way that feels almost hands-off. Watering happens based on a set schedule that aligns with the needs of the landscape rather than memory or availability. Adjustments can be made once, then left to run without constant involvement. 

Lighting That Follows the Day

Lights stay on longer than needed or remain off when they would add comfort. Adjusting them throughout the day becomes another small task that competes for attention.

Automated lighting systems bring alignment between the home and daily routines. Lights transition gradually, responding to time and activity rather than requiring direct input. Morning light feels intentional, evening lighting feels settled, and the overall atmosphere stays balanced. 

Automation works through consistency, removing the small, repeated actions that quietly fill up daily routines. Each system contributes in its own way, creating a space that responds, adjusts, and maintains itself with minimal input.
